sure, zeroth draft:
Bad Vcs-* URLs include:
Vcs-(Arch|Cvs|Darcs|Hg|Bzr|Svn):.*debian\.org
Vcs-Git:.*(git|anonscm|alioth)\.debian\.org
Vcs-Browser:.*(svn|bzr|darcs|git|hg|anoncms|anonscm|alioth)\.debian\.org
vcs-field-uses-deprecated-infrastructure
The VCS-* field contains a URI pointing at the deprecated alioth.debian.org
infrastructure. The servers will become read-only in May 2018. Packages can
migrate to git hosting on salsa.debian.org.
For further information about salsa.debian.org, see:
https://wiki.debian.org/Salsa
HTTP redirects from alioth to salsa can be made by requesting that they added
to the AliothRewriter project:
https://salsa.debian.org/salsa/AliothRewriter/
Tools to help with the migration exist, including:
https://salsa.debian.org/mehdi/salsa-scripts/
